WebOn the Legislative Council ballot paper, you have two ways to vote – above or below the line. Vote above the line: The voter has the choice of group voting (usually for a particular party). This is done above the line. The voter places the number “1” in one of the squares to indicate the political party selected as the first choice. WebElections for Councillors are held every four years in the month of September. All residents of the Shire who are over 18 years of age are required to vote in the local Council election. Local Government elections are governed by the NSW Electoral Commission and this election date is the same for all Council elections in New South Wales. WebSep 15, 2024 · The NSW Electoral Commission is a statutory authority comprising three members appointed by the Governor of NSW. The commission approves funding to independent MPs, candidates and parties and enforces provisions of three NSW Acts. It can conduct and promote research into electoral matters.
